Design Principles for Intimate Apparel

Designing intimate apparel requires a deep understanding of the human body and its proportions. Intimate apparel designers must consider factors such as comfort, support, and aesthetics when creating their designs. The intimate apparel course covers various design principles, including the use of color, texture, and pattern to create visually appealing garments. Students also learn about the importance of fit and sizing in intimate apparel, as well as the latest trends and technologies in the field.

Design Tools and Software

Intimate apparel designers use a range of design tools and software, including computer-aided design (CAD) programs and 3D modeling software. These tools enable designers to create accurate prototypes and simulate the fit and drape of their designs. The intimate apparel course provides students with hands-on experience of these design tools and software, preparing them for a career in the industry.

Sustainability in Intimate Apparel

The intimate apparel industry has a significant environmental impact, from the production of raw materials to the disposal of end-of-life products. The intimate apparel course covers the importance of sustainability in the industry, including the use of eco-friendly materials, reduction of waste, and implementation of recycling programs. Students learn about the latest sustainable technologies and innovations in intimate apparel, such as the use of recycled fibers and biodegradable fabrics.

Sustainable Materials

Sustainable materials are becoming increasingly popular in the intimate apparel industry, with many brands opting for eco-friendly materials such as organic cotton, recycled polyester, and Tencel. These materials offer several benefits, including reduced environmental impact, improved durability, and enhanced comfort. The intimate apparel course provides students with a comprehensive understanding of sustainable materials and their applications in the industry.
